Civil Liberties Inquiry On Surveillance
September 11, 2013
The Civil Liberties (LIBE) committee from the European Parliament hold a first hearing, attended by Jacques Follorou from Le Monde, Jacob Applebaum from the Tor and Wikileaks projects, Alan Rusbridger, editor in chief of the Guardian, Carlos Coelho, EPP MEP and former chairman of the Echelon committee and Gerhard Schmid, former socialist MEP and rapporteur of the Echelon report and Duncan Campell, investigative journalist on the 5th of September.
